Why Incorporate Video into Your Real Estate CRM?

  1. Capturing Attention: Video has the incredible ability to captivate. Eye-catching videos are more likely to engage potential buyers, encouraging them to linger longer on your property listings. This heightened engagement can translate into increased inquiries and more property showings.
  2. Building Trust: A professional video portfolio fosters trust among your clients. It demonstrates your dedication to showcasing their properties in the best possible light, leaving no room for doubt about your commitment to their success.
  3. Time Efficiency: No more juggling multiple emails with bulky attachments or external website links. Integrating video content directly into your CRM streamlines the process.
  4. Personalisation: Video integration empowers you to personalise your marketing efforts. Craft virtual tours, neighbourhood highlight videos, and other tailored content to cater to specific client preferences, enhancing your ability to connect on a personal level.

Steps to Seamlessly Integrate Videography into Your CRM

Now that we’ve highlighted the advantages, let’s explore how to seamlessly weave professional photography and videography into your CRM:

  1. Select the Right CRM: Begin by selecting a CRM system that supports video integration. 
  2. Collaborate with Professionals: Forge partnerships with photographers and videographers specialising in real estate. Their expertise in capturing properties in the best possible light and creating compelling videos is invaluable.
  3. Streamline Media Organisation: Once you possess your videos, it’s essential to organise them within your CRM. A good CRM will allow you to easily store your videos against the listing or insert links to the video URL.
  4. Enhance Listings: Elevate your property listings by incorporating images and videos. Include a diverse range of shots, encompassing interiors, exteriors, and aerial views, to provide potential buyers with a comprehensive perspective.
  5. Simplify Sharing: With integrated videos, sharing these assets becomes a breeze. You can effortlessly send email campaigns, create social adverts and insert videos onto your agency website.
